Spain: Robinho and Woodgate in Real Madrid squad for opener at Cadiz [Sat Aug 27th, 2005]

Madrid (Reuters) - New signing Robinho and centre-back Jonathan Woodgate have been included in Real Madrid's 20-strong squad to face promoted Cadiz in their opening league match of the season.

Robinho, who completed his US$30 million move to Real from Santos, trained with his new team-mates including fellow Brazil internationals Ronaldo, Roberto Carlos and Julio Baptista for the first time.

Real boss Vanderlei Luxemburgo, who also coached Robinho at Santos, said the 21-year-old would not start the game against Cadiz, but could make an appearance.

Woodgate, who was sidelined for his first season at Real because of a thigh injury, made his debut for Real when he was given a brief four-minute run-out at the end of the pre-season friendly against the MLS All-Stars.

The 25-year-old will not play against Cadiz but will travel with his team mates as part of Luxemburgo's plans for his gradual introduction after his 16-month injury lay-off.

England striker Michael Owen, whose future at the Bernabeu is still in the balance after an offer from Newcastle United and possible interest from Liverpool, was also included in the squad.
